District Employees Recognized With Their Own Night at Rangers Ballpark
Article Date: April 29, 2009
Workers throughout the district gathered in Arlington last Friday for Garland ISD Employee Appreciation Night at Rangers Ballpark.
![]() |
The annual event is hosted by the Texas Rangers and recognizes GISD for its efforts in public education by offering discounted tickets to all employees and their families.
Campus Teachers of the Year are led onto the field and introduced as a group at home plate during pre-game festivities. More than 60 teachers were recognized at Friday night’s game.
Keith Reimer of the BEST Foundation tossed out the ceremonial first pitch. Texas lost to the Kansas City Royals, 12-3.
